Consent banner (Project Ashgrove) rollout notes:
- Staged at 10% on Brimley region; opt-out rates nominal.
- Legal copy v3 approved; v2 deprecated Friday.
- Blocker: banner flickers on slow connections; fix in review.
- Full rollout gated on telemetry dashboard sign-off.
Escalations for the rollout go to the owner named below.

account owner for fajep-yagef: Kasix Eliiel

// DEDUPE_MATCH_THRESHOLD controls how aggressively the Lornquist pipeline
// merges candidate customer records. Support team: if a customer reports a
// wrongly merged account, check whether their records scored just above this
// value before filing a data-repair ticket. Raising it reduces false merges
// but leaves more duplicates visible in the console. The threshold was last
// tuned in the build identified by the token below.

session token of tajef-bageg = htk21_5d90d574934f3ccae6437

**Q: How do bulk edits work in the Marrowfield admin table?**

Bulk edits are not row-by-row updates. The client sends a single patch descriptor and the server applies it in one transaction, capped at 500 rows. Reviewers should check that new bulk actions go through the descriptor path — direct loops over the row API will get rejected in review and can lock the table. Descriptor format, validation rules, and example patches are documented on the internal page below.

wiki page, hahif-hahif: https://argocd.kelvisys.corp/browse/board/settings/pages/1442e0b1065d83f1

Welcome aboard — here's your first action item from the Parcelwright fee-engine postmortem. Short version: the rules engine recomputed shipping fees on every cart mutation, and during the Brindlemoor flash sale that meant ~40 evaluations per checkout instead of 2. Caching was disabled because a stale-fee bug spooked us last year, but we've since added version stamps, so it's safe now. Your task: re-enable the rule cache with the agreed TTLs and eviction sizes, behind a flag. The constants we signed off on are below.

tuning constants:
QUOTAS = {
    "druwyn": 5,
    "holix": 5,
    "zorath": 5,
    "holwyn": 10,
}